How To Fix HRGB_GBSXP636 - Birth Cert.(&1): Issued Date must be entered


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: HRGB_GBSXP - Message for GBSXP

  • Message number: 636

  • Message text: Birth Cert.(&1): Issued Date must be entered

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message HRGB_GBSXP636 - Birth Cert.(&1): Issued Date must be entered ?

    The SAP error message HRGB_GBSXP636 indicates that there is a missing or invalid entry for the "Issued Date" of a birth certificate in the system. This error typically arises in the context of employee data management, particularly when dealing with personal information such as birth certificates.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Data: The "Issued Date" field for the birth certificate is not filled in.
    2. Invalid Format: The date entered may not be in the correct format or may not be a valid date.
    3. Configuration Issues: There may be issues with the configuration of the infotype or the data entry screen that is causing the field to be required but not properly displayed.

    Solution:

    1. Enter the Issued Date: Navigate to the relevant infotype (usually IT 0021 for "Family Member/Dependents") and ensure that the "Issued Date" for the birth certificate is filled in correctly.
    2. Check Date Format: Ensure that the date is entered in the correct format as required by your SAP system settings (e.g., DD/MM/YYYY or MM/DD/YYYY).
    3. Review Configuration: If the field is not visible or seems to be malfunctioning, check with your SAP administrator or HR module consultant to ensure that the infotype is configured correctly.
    4. Data Validation: Ensure that all other required fields are also filled out correctly, as sometimes errors can cascade from other missing information.

    Related Information:

    • Infotype 0021: This infotype is used to manage family member data, including birth certificates.
